The Association between Obstructive Sleep Apnea and Venous Thromboembolism: A Bidirectional Two-Sample Mendelian

Summary
This study found no genetic link between obstructive sleep apnea (OSA) and venous thromboembolism (VTE), including pulmonary embolism (PE) and deep vein thrombosis (DVT). Mendelian randomization analysis confirmed no causal relationship in either direction.
Area of Science:
- Cardiovascular Research
- Sleep Medicine
- Genetics
Background:
- Observational studies suggest a link between obstructive sleep apnea (OSA) and venous thromboembolism (VTE), but findings are inconsistent.
- This controversy necessitates further investigation into the potential causal relationship between OSA and VTE.
Purpose of the Study:
- To investigate the potential causal association between obstructive sleep apnea (OSA) and venous thromboembolism (VTE) using genetic data.
- To explore the relationship in both directions: OSA influencing VTE risk and VTE influencing OSA risk.
Main Methods:
- A bidirectional two-sample Mendelian randomization (MR) analysis was employed.
- Summary-level data from large-scale genome-wide association studies in European populations were utilized.
- Inverse variance weighted, MR-Egger, weighted median, and MR-PRESSO methods were used, alongside sensitivity analyses.
Main Results:
- Genetically predicted obstructive sleep apnea (OSA) showed no significant effect on the risk of venous thromboembolism (VTE), including pulmonary embolism (PE) and deep vein thrombosis (DVT).
- Reverse Mendelian randomization analysis also found no substantial evidence of an association between VTE and OSA.
- Sensitivity analyses and complementary MR methods corroborated the primary findings.
Conclusions:
- The study found no genetic evidence to support a significant association between obstructive sleep apnea (OSA) and venous thromboembolism (VTE).
- The bidirectional Mendelian randomization analysis indicates no causal relationship between OSA and VTE in either direction.

Sleep Apnea
148
Sleep apnea is a condition where breathing stops intermittently during sleep, often leading to significant health issues. Each episode can last from 10 to 20 seconds or more and is frequently accompanied by a brief arousal from sleep. This disturbance, largely unnoticed by the individual, can lead to severe daytime fatigue. Commonly, individuals seek help after being informed by their partners about loud snoring and noticeable breathing pauses during sleep.

Other Pulmonary Disorders
836
Respiratory disorders encompass a range of conditions with varying levels of severity. Asthma, marked by chronic airway inflammation and hypersensitivity, is one such condition. It can lead to airway obstruction due to factors like bronchial spasms, mucosal edema, increased mucus secretion, or epithelial damage. Asthma triggers are diverse, ranging from allergens to emotional upset, and treatment focuses on both immediate relief through bronchodilators and long-term inflammation suppression.
